You need to sort an array of structures based upon a numeric first field:
For example :
a.n=1; a.name='a'; b.n=3; b.name='b'; c.n=2; c.name='c'; array = [a b c]
This array of 3 structures is not sorted yet since:
>> array(2)
shows: ans =
n: 3
name: 'b'The aim is to have for this example the output array such as :
>> array(1)
ans =
n: 1
name: 'a'>> array(2)
ans =
n: 2
name: 'c'>> array(3)
ans =
n: 3
name: 'b'The input of this problem is an array of structures. .
